- 2021 Legislative Summary is now available for CASB members — it provides an overview of the actions impacting K-12 education during the last legislative session. This summary discusses what did and did not happen during the session; presents key issues and priorities; provides a bill summary for key legislation; and, sets the stage for the November 2021 election.
